LEAHI-DIALIN-LDT-2998

DENBUG-331: Duplicate Device Logs Uploading to Modaflx Connect

- Change CS rejection reason order to reject reason then logname

- Add log Tally fn

- Change Log Upload, Log backup to use log tally

- Change findpending to be dynamic due to tally changes

- Change pending/uploaded extension format to account for tally with %1

    • -31
    • +23
    /sources/device/DeviceController.cpp
DENBUG-331: Duplicate Device Logs Uploading to Modaflx Connect

- add duplicate function for 2010

    • -0
    • +35
    /sources/device/DeviceController.cpp
DENBUG-331: Duplicate Device Logs Uploading to Modaflx Connect

Address CR comments

    • -1
    • +9
    /sources/cloudsync/CloudSyncController.h
DENBUG-331: Duplicate Device Logs Uploading to Modaflx Connect

- Add new error message for cloudsync for log duplicates

- Add more parameters to 2010 signal

- add Switch case logic for 2010 reject reason. Logic to be implemented and discussed

    • -1351
    • +1369
    /sources/cloudsync/CloudSyncController.cpp
    • -331
    • +333
    /sources/cloudsync/CloudSyncController.h
    • -4
    • +12
    /sources/device/DeviceController.cpp
Merged FP into DD test configs

Merged FP into DD test configs

Renamed

Renamed

Fixed

Fixed

Added enum to FP and TD Configs.

Added enum to FP and TD Configs.

Vinayakam Mani What is the advantage of doing that? If I go with Beta_1_9_HW, I will need to rename the flag when we start using Beta 2+. And rename it in all the scripts in different repository wh...

Vinayakam Mani What is the advantage of doing that?
If I go with Beta_1_9_HW, I will need to rename the flag when we start using Beta 2+. And rename it in all the scripts in different repository when starting with 2.0.
While I use a more generic flag, I won't need to do that. So just using a better name I am sparing myself hours of work in the future.

You may use the same test configs from DD here, to set the relevant test configs from FP Dialin.

You may use the same test configs from DD here, to set the relevant test configs from FP Dialin.

POS_FIELD_3??

POS_FIELD_3??

Please follow the same naming convention as firmware enums.

Please follow the same naming convention as firmware enums.

Bamboo Commit: Updated the Copyright section and replaced tabs with 4 spaces

    • -0
    • +14
    /sources/model/settings/MWifiNetwork.h
Bamboo Commit: Updated the Copyright section and replaced tabs with 4 spaces

    • -14
    • +0
    /sources/model/settings/MWifiNetwork.h
Bamboo Commit: Updated the Copyright section and replaced tabs with 4 spaces

    • -0
    • +14
    /sources/model/dg/data/MDGGeneralEvent.h
Bamboo Commit: Updated the Copyright section and replaced tabs with 4 spaces

  1. … 607 more files in changeset.
Understand. In this case, the spare positions correspond to bit positions in the FPGA register and the new valves took the 1, 2, and 6 spots.

Understand. In this case, the spare positions correspond to bit positions in the FPGA register and the new valves took the 1, 2, and 6 spots.

Fixed Typo

Fixed Typo

Ok (But feels weird to start the counting of existing items from 0 if that's the spare3 instead of 1. Calling the D79 the "zeroeth" spare valve instead of the first spare valve... Personally I thin...

Ok
(But feels weird to start the counting of existing items from 0 if that's the spare3 instead of 1. Calling the D79 the "zeroeth" spare valve instead of the first spare valve... Personally I think we should name them Spare1-8 instead of Spare 0-7)

In f/w, the spares are numbered 3, 4, 5, and 7 (not 1..4).

In f/w, the spares are numbered 3, 4, 5, and 7 (not 1..4).

interval?

interval?

Updated according to changes of LEAHI-DD-FIRMWARE-LDT-2998-1

Updated according to changes of LEAHI-DD-FIRMWARE-LDT-2998-1

Match with the firmware in LDT-2998.

Match with the firmware in LDT-2998.

Fixed

Fixed

Updated

Updated

D98 has been renamed

D98 has been renamed